  1. Stockton Corporation Transport ran services in partnership with Thornaby town Council to cover journeys throught the borough. The corporation boundary was therefore the old river bridge on the Wilderness road. In those days for purpose of accounting and distribution of revenues to both Stockton and Middlesbrough Councils; passengers wanting to travel to Middlesbrough purchased 2 tickets one to the Old River. The second from the Old River to their destination. By the time I worked on the buses in the mid ’60s this system had been modified with through tickets.
